#16323d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#16323d is composed of 8.6% red, 19.6%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.9% cyan, 18% magenta, 0% yellow and 76.1% black. It has a hue angle of 196.9 degrees, a saturation of 47% and a lightness of 16.3%. #16323d color hex could be obtained by blending #2c647a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

#16323d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#16323d has RGB values of R:22, G:50, B:61 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0.18, Y:0, K:0.76. Its decimal value is 1454653.

Shades and Tints of #16323d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010303 is the darkest color, while #f4f9f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#16323d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#292a2a is the less saturated color, while #033a50 is the most saturated one.
